About Combination Squares

A combination square is an indispensable precision tool that brings together multiple measuring and marking functions in one robust, portable instrument. At its core, this versatile tool comprises a graduated steel blade—typically available in 150mm or 300mm lengths—paired with a sliding head that locks securely at any position along the ruler. The head features precision-ground reference faces at both 90 degrees and 45 degrees, enabling tradespeople to check right angles, mark perfect mitres, measure depths, gauge heights, and verify levels with exceptional accuracy. This multi-functional capability makes the combination square one of the most frequently reached-for tools in carpentry, metalwork, and general construction.

Jargon Buster

  • Blade/Rule: The graduated steel ruler component that slides through the stock. Features metric measurements (and sometimes imperial) etched or printed along its length, typically ranging from 150mm to 300mm for standard models, though specialist engineering versions may extend to 600mm.
  • Stock/Head: The main body component that slides and locks onto the blade. Houses the precision-ground 90-degree and 45-degree reference edges, often incorporates a spirit level vial, and typically includes storage for the scribe pin.
  • Scribe: A hardened steel pin stored within the head, used for marking or scribing precise lines on metal, timber, plastic, and other materials. Can be removed and replaced when the point becomes worn through regular use.
  • Spirit Level Vial: A small bubble level integrated into the head, allowing quick verification that surfaces are level or plumb without requiring a separate spirit level tool—particularly useful when working alone or in confined spaces.
  • Lock Nut/Thumbscrew: The tightening mechanism that secures the head firmly at any position along the blade, ensuring it remains absolutely stationary during measuring, marking, or checking operations. Quality models feature knurled brass or steel thumbscrews for reliable grip even with gloved hands.
  • Precision Ground Faces: The reference surfaces on the stock that have been machined to exact 90-degree and 45-degree angles through precision grinding processes. These faces are critical for accurate square and mitre checks, and any damage or wear to these surfaces compromises the tool's entire function.

How to Choose the Right Combination Squares

Blade Length: The most common sizes are 150mm (6") and 300mm (12"). A 150mm square suits general carpentry, working in tight spaces, detailed joinery, and most DIY applications. A 300mm model proves invaluable for larger timber sections, sheet materials like plywood and MDF, site carpentry, and steelwork fabrication. Many professional tradespeople maintain both sizes in their toolkit for maximum versatility across different job requirements.

Material Quality and Construction: Premium models feature stainless steel blades that resist corrosion in damp site conditions—particularly important given British weather—and maintain their etched graduations indefinitely. Cast iron heads offer excellent durability, weight for stability, and resistance to accidental drops, whilst aluminium versions reduce overall weight for easier carrying in tool belts and bags. Budget models typically use chrome-plated carbon steel, which provides adequate performance for occasional use but proves more susceptible to rust when exposed to moisture.

Accuracy Grade and Precision: Professional-grade combination squares from ranges such as Bahco Prestige, Stanley FatMax, and Faithfull Prestige offer guaranteed accuracy typically within 0.1mm over 100mm, with precision-ground reference faces machined to exacting tolerances. These prove essential for fine joinery, furniture making, metalwork fabrication, and any application where tight tolerances are critical. Standard-grade models suit general carpentry, construction work, and DIY projects where tolerances are less demanding.

Frequently Asked Questions

How do I check if my combination square is still accurate?

Place the square against a known straight edge—such as a precision machined ruler or a factory edge of quality plywood or MDF—and draw a fine line along the 90-degree face using a sharp pencil or marking knife. Flip the square over and align it with the same line from the opposite direction. If the blade aligns perfectly with your drawn line, the square remains true. Any visible gap indicates the head has been damaged or knocked out of square, and the tool should be replaced, as most combination squares cannot be successfully recalibrated once the precision-ground faces are compromised.

What's the difference between a combination square and a try square?

A try square has a fixed blade set permanently at 90 degrees to the stock, making it excellent for dedicated squareness checking and offering maximum rigidity for this specific function. However, a combination square's sliding blade provides adjustable depth gauging, height measurement from surfaces, 45-degree mitre checking, and can be used as an independent ruler when the head is removed. The combination square delivers far greater versatility for the money, whilst the try square may offer slightly better rigidity and repeatability for specific dedicated squaring tasks in workshop environments.

Can I use a combination square for both metalwork and woodwork?

Absolutely. Quality combination squares work excellently across multiple materials and disciplines. The scribe is specifically designed for marking metal surfaces where pencils won't leave visible lines, whilst the blade edge works perfectly for pencil marking on timber. Many metalworkers and fabricators prefer stainless steel models as they demonstrate superior resistance to the cutting oils, coolants, and general moisture common in machine shops and fabrication workshops, whilst remaining equally effective for carpentry applications.

How should I maintain my combination square?

Keep the blade clean and apply a light coating of engineering oil to prevent rust, especially after exposure to the damp site conditions typical throughout British weather. Regularly clean sawdust, metal filings, and general debris from the groove in the head using a stiff brush or compressed air. Never use the square as a makeshift hammer, pry bar, or scraper, as impacts and lateral stress can knock the head out of square or damage the precision-ground faces. Store in a dry location, preferably in a dedicated tool roll or case to protect the critical reference edges from accidental damage. Periodically check accuracy using the straight-edge method described above.
